After that heartbreaking episode two death, there's no doubt that The Last Of Us is now a show much changed, but it's going from strength-to-strength in season two. At the forefront of that cast is Bella Ramsey and Isabela Merced - the two best friends Ellie and Dina who are figuring out what their relationship really means... against the backdrop of multiple daily threats of death after a mushroom-zombie apocalypse.
Playing ELLE UK's Knowing Me, Knowing You, where they guessed which of their cast mates were attached to surprising facts, the pair took some time to reminisce on filming their first kiss in episode one.

While the pair did have an intimacy co-ordinator on set and worked with them on the scene, they shared that they didn't rehearse the kiss as such.
'We did it the first time on the first take - rehearsing kisses is always so weird,' said Bella. 'Yeah, It feels like spin the bottle,’ added Isabela.
‘But that was a really beautiful scene and it was so nice for people to be happy for 10 minutes in the world of The Last Of Us,' says Bella.
But it wasn't just a special moment on screen for fans, the pair shared that they had a lovely moment before the series aired.
'It was very magical filming it and then when we had playback with a bunch of gay women it was so so sweet everyone had tears in their eyes,' said Isabela.
'It was really special,' added Bella.
And while on the other end of the scale, Bella does enjoy the many fight scenes the show is known for she did note, 'the amount of fight scenes I had to do this season was exhausting’ and that they were mostly powered by mint and Yorkshire tea.
